Output 315358cd309a8cdc821a8367180b78de7aec75c7f9b14ff901270a65ea326177:95

value
44263
script pubkey
OP_0 OP_PUSHBYTES_20 66137c70b211bdf3e006a4790072a4eea01f1710
address
bc1qvcfhcu9jzx7l8cqx53usqu4ya6sp79cs3adw5c
transaction
315358cd309a8cdc821a8367180b78de7aec75c7f9b14ff901270a65ea326177